I have a question:
Is it required to have "party certification" under constitutional law, or is this more of a ceremonial certification?
In other words, is he eligible to run anyway without approval? I'm still looking but I haven't seen anything saying it's required. Can somebody point me in the right direction before I make a judgement?
To suggest it is ceremonial sounds like you are asking why does it matter if a person is certified by the national party ?
Each state has an election commission with the responsibility to decide who gets their name on an election ballot.
The rules vary among states and without certification by a recognized party the task of being included on the ballots in
all election districts is close to impossible. Each election commision must be satisfied that candidates are eligible to
hold the office they seek. The election commissions can rely of the national party certification of candidates, so yes the
certification by the national party is very important.
